Fine needle aspiration cytologic findings in the black thyroid syndrome
Authors:K J Wajda  M S Wilson  J Lucas  W L Marsh
Institution:Department of Pathology, Ohio State University, Columbus 43210.
Abstract:The cytologic presentation of a case of minocycline-associated black thyroid adenoma in a 30-year-old woman is described. A nodule was discovered in the left lobe of the patient's thyroid gland, and fine needle aspiration (FNA) was performed; the nodule and adjacent thyroid were subsequently surgically removed. The cytologic findings included sparse groups of epithelial cells with prominent intracytoplasmic pigment granules. The surgical specimen was interpreted as black thyroid adenoma. This case is unusual in that the pigment had accumulated preferentially in the adenoma. In retrospect, the finding of distinctive pigment in the aspirate of the nodule suggests that the black thyroid syndrome should be considered whenever dark-brown pigment is encountered in FNA cytologic specimens from the thyroid gland.
